Embark on an unforgettable 3-hour walking tour through Budapest, Hungary, and discover the distinct charm of both Buda and Pest. Led by a knowledgeable local guide, this tour unveils the city’s most iconic landmarks and panoramic views, providing the perfect introduction for first-time visitors.
Begin your journey at the majestic Saint Stephen's Basilica, then stroll past the impressive Hungarian Parliament building. Your guide will share fascinating stories of Budapest’s history and culture, ensuring you gain a deeper appreciation for the city’s unique character along the way.
The adventure continues as you cross the scenic Danube River using convenient public transport, connecting you from the bustling streets of Pest to the historic hills of Buda. Marvel at the architectural splendor of Matthias Church, Buda Castle, and the Royal Palace, each site steeped in centuries of heritage.
Throughout the tour, your guide offers a highly personalized experience, happily answering questions and tailoring insights to your interests. This walking tour is ideal for travelers of all ages and interests, making it an engaging and accessible way to explore Budapest’s vibrant atmosphere.
